Rencounter Krav Maga Edinburgh is a premier self-defense school located in the Merchiston area, offering realistic training for all ages. The club provides a variety of classes, including foundation courses for beginners and tailored training for experienced students. Core instruction focuses on Krav Maga techniques, self-defense skills, and tactical awareness for real-world safety. Specialized seminars such as Pub Brawl and Control and Restraint are offered throughout the year to enhance student capabilities.

Edinburgh Osteopathic Clinic is a professional healthcare practice located on Mountcastle Drive North in Edinburgh. The clinic specializes in diagnosing and treating a wide range of musculoskeletal issues, including back and neck pain. Core services include osteopathic adjustments, sports injury recovery, and specialized treatment for pinched nerves. The practitioner takes the time to explain the root cause of pain and develops tailored treatment plans for each patient. Maintenance sessions are also offered to help individuals in physical jobs prolong their careers and stay pain-free.
